uPVC windows can experience issues opening or locking. This is usually the case when the locking mechanism is stiff or stuck. You can lubricate your lock and handle with graphite or machine oil. This will allow the mechanism to free up and the window or door to operate normally once more.

The hinges may become stiff or even stuck. This is usually caused by dust and grit building up on the hinges with time. Lubricating the hinges using oil or grease is the solution. Using the wrong type of grease, however, could cause damage and cause the hinges to become unusable.

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ping prevents air and water from entering homes through gaps surrounding doors and windows. It is an important part of home maintenance that could save money on energy bills and costly repairs. It also makes a home more comfortable. However the materials used to create this seal can deteriorate as time passes due to wear and tear, which makes it important to replace the seals from time to time.

There are several signs that your weather stripping is beginning to wear out: a moist area after washing your window; a whistling sound when driving down the street or drafts that can be felt at the front of a closed door. These are all good indicators that it's time for an expert in weatherstripping repair near me.

Taskers can seal your doors and windows with a variety of weatherstripping materials. Foam tapes can be made of closed or open cell foam. They are available in a variety of thicknesses, widths and qualities. They are simple to install and can be cut using scissors. Felt strips are also affordable and usually last for about a year or two. They can be cut to length with scissors and then attached to the frame of the door or the hinge side of a double glazed window Repairs near Me-hung or sliding window using staples, glue or tacks. Metal or vinyl V strips are a bit more difficult to install, but can be secured with nails along the window jamb.
